What happened
In late July, actress Bryce Dallas Howard visited DonorsChoose headquarters to reconnect with her high school English teacher, affectionately known as Mr. Scotch. Their reunion was a heartwarming moment, recalling how he encouraged her during a time when she struggled with learning disabilities and felt unsure about her academic path. Despite her initial discomfort in English class, Scotch recognized her resilience and potential, transforming her experience and confidence.
This meeting also highlighted the broader reality that many teachers often invest their own resources in classrooms to help students succeed. Scotch shared stories of covering field trips, supplies, and other expenses out of pocket throughout his career, underscoring the dedication educators have even amid limited funding. Bryce’s story was a powerful example of what can happen when teachers are supported and truly see their students’ abilities.
